hey i was scrolling through the files on the nx-60 and i saw the files stdio.h, stlib.h, math.h and some other header files. I was wondering if there was any way i could write c/c++ programs on my clie. Also is there any way i could write dos on my clie

This post really belongs in the developer forum, but yes you can. Also I'm assuming these weren't in RAM on the Clie (I don't know how they would have gotten there). There's a tool called OnBoardC that you can use to develop application on the handheld (it actually compiles them on the handheld itself, hence the name :)). There is also a program that emulates DOS for Palm...I forget the name but you can find it around (search palmgear, I think its there). Both programs are freeware, but you will need RsrcEdit to generate resources which is shareware to do anything interesting GUI wise.
